General
- All skills with offensive scaling now scale off your total physical or magical damage and not only your weapon (which still wasn't working as it was saying, it was weird thing that needed to be fixed). All the major skill changes are listed below. This change makes almost all skills stronger.
- Increased amount of souls gained more by disassembling higher level equipment.
- Added a quest that unlocks with Ryvius bounty. This quest makes you hunt Ryvius 3 times. You're rewarded with a Mist Elf part of your choice (except the helmet because it already has a quest
- CD of Double Shot and Diffusion Cannon has been decreased to 6 seconds
- All summoner Boss weapons bonuses from their normal counterparts have been reduced to 30% from 90%

If you ever asked yourself how summoners could reach such insane attack values here is your answer. After investigating items and weapons around their class I found out that Boss weapons are simply normal weapons increased by 90% in their damage stats, which obviously results in way too high damage if you compare to other classes and weapons. This is especially amplified by their base scalings on their basic attacks, which always sits at around 120% instead of 100%. Strangely enough, it is very hard to find where these numbers are based off and it yet remains a mystery to me. Despite that, Summoners are still a very viable class, just not as overpowered. They also retail some more strength in their abilities now along side other QoL changes to some of their skills in terms of cast time. Feel free to combine normal attacks and skills.

Battlesquare- Battlesquare rewards have been changed:
- Individual Gold reward: Raised to 10 - 350g from points 1000 to 6000
- Team Dust reward increased to up to 400 w/a dust at 60k points for wins
Skills
To clarify, initially after the changes the way numbers worked in general made some skills (especially the first class ones) extremely weak (skills that would have only 30% scaling off total damage). Those were mostly raised by 100% to accurate match how they should have been and aren't mentioned here. Though, worth to mention is that all basic attacks are around 100%, with down attacks etc. being at around 120%.
Else, many skills would also be around scalings that would be too high in comparison to their old versions. So a lot of adjustments have been made. Over all, all skills are scaling better now and deal more damage.
All changes listed are about Lv. 1 - 5. Levels 6 - 10 are not included in the notes.
